Please centrifuge briefly before opening (volume ≤2 ml).Description:
NTP Mix / 25 mM is an equimolar mixture of 25 mM ATP, CTP, GTP and UTP supplied as ultrapure aqueous solution and suitable for all molecular biology applications including in vitro transcription and RNA labeling.Shipping: shipped on gel packs
Storage Conditions: store at -20 °C
Shelf Life: 12 months
Molecular Formula:
ATP: C10H16N5O13P3 (free acid)
CTP: C9H16N3O14P3 (free acid)
GTP: C10H16N5O14P3 (free acid)
UTP: C9H15N2O15P3 (free acid)Molecular Weight:
ATP: 507.18 g/mol (free acid)
CTP: 483.16 g/mol (free acid)
GTP: 523.18 g/mol (free acid)
UTP: 484.14 g/mol (free acid)Purity: ≥ 99 % (HPLC)
Form: clear aqueous solution
Concentration: 25 mM each nucleotide
pH: 8.0 ±0.2 (22 °C)
Quality Control Specifications:
in vitro transcription: suitable
contamination with bacterial and human DNA: not detectable
